How much fluid to replenish after diabetic ketoacidosis

The principle of the whole treatment for diabetic ketoacidosis patients is rehydration, and large amount of rehydration is very crucial, usually 1000-2000ml in the first hour, this rate is for most people, and the rehydration rate needs to be slowed down for people with heart failure. In the first day, that is, the first 24 hours, the entire amount of rehydration can reach 5000-8000m, because a large amount of rehydration can improve the entire microcirculatory state of the patient, the subsequent use of insulin treatment to achieve the corresponding effect, so as to play the purpose of reducing ketone bodies and blood sugar, so rehydration is crucial for patients with diabetic ketoacidosis, the control of the amount and speed of rehydration is also Therefore, rehydration is crucial for patients with diabetic ketoacidosis, and the control of rehydration amount and rehydration rate is also very important.
